Aaron Boone Provides Update on Aaron Judge’s Injury

The New York Yankees placed outfielder Aaron Judge on the 10-day injured list over the weekend with a flexor strain in his right elbow. Though Judge will have to miss some time, he did avoid a more serious injury or any damage to his ulnar collateral ligament, and his elbow will not require surgery.

“I think we in the big picture dodged something pretty good,” Yankees manager Aaron Boone told Talkin’ Yanks on Tuesday. “Hopefully this little bit of downtime does the trick and also serves as a little bit of a physical reset for him in a long season where you’re playing every day.”

Boone added that he thinks Judge will begin hitting off the tee on Tuesday or Wednesday, and will resume throwing 10-15 days after the injury. Boone remains unsure of how long it will take Judge to be ready to go in the outfield after he starts throwing again.

Per Bryan Hoch of MLB.com, Boone said the “hope” is that Judge will play as the designated hitter when he’s eligible to return from the IL on Aug. 5.

The Yankees have talked to designated hitter Giancarlo Stanton about playing outfield with Judge out and for depth down the stretch. Though Stanton is “eager” about the opportunity and will do some drills in the outfield this week, Boone is unsure if he will actually use Stanton in that role.
